The video discusses the uncertainty in 2020, focusing on themes like the slowing global economy, monetary tightening, inflation, and the Ukraine-Russia conflict. It explores the bond market, fixed income strategies, and the impact of inflation on market outlook. The energy sector's opportunities amidst geopolitical tensions are also highlighted, with a focus on natural gas and renewable energy.
